The field of language assessment is an active and ever-changing field of applied linguistics scholarship. With interconnections with many linguistic subfields--from language teaching to language policy to the sociolinguistics of immigration--language assessment has a real, measurable impact on the lives of language learners, both in the contexts of first and foreign language learning. In an increasingly globalized world, language assessment must continue to evolve in concert with the needs of language learners worldwide. First published in 2014, The Companion to Language Assessment was the first works of its kind. As a four-volume major reference work, it brought together the full field of language assessment into a comprehensive resource that examined all aspects of language assessment across 35 world languages. Building upon the success of the major reference work, The Concise Companion to Language Assessment will collect a selection of some of the most popular chapters from the full work, along with a large selection of wholly new chapters, in a single-volume edition for undergraduate, post-graduate, and graduate students studying language assessment, language teaching and learning, TESOL, second language acquisition, language policy, and other related fields. The Concise Companion accounts for the most recent changes in the field through an increased focus on technology in language assessment and classroom-based assessment, with new coverage of learning-oriented assessment, teacher-based assessment, teacher assessment literacy, writing, pronunciation, speaking, plurilingual assessment, assessment for immigration, and many others. The Concise Companion will also include an almost entirely new selection of articles on innovations in assessment, and throughout the work, new emphasis will be placed on the impacts of colonialism and discrimination on the history of language assessment. In 56 chapters--29 of which will be new-- The Concise Companion to Language Assessment will provide an ideal reference for students pursuing degrees in applied linguistics who are interested in working in language assessment, education, and policy.
